Understanding Private Label Liquid B Complex

What is Private Label Liquid B Complex?

Private label liquid B complex refers to dietary supplements that contain a blend of essential B vitamins in a liquid form, marketed under a retailer’s brand name. These products are manufactured by a third party and offer an opportunity for brand owners to sell high-quality nutritional products without the need for extensive manufacturing facilities or research and development efforts. This flexibility allows for quick entry into the health supplement market, catering to the increasing consumer demand for convenient and effective nutrient delivery methods. Difference Between Private and White Label Supplements

The terms ‘private label’ and ‘white label’ are often used interchangeably, but there are key differences that affect branding and product formulation. Private label products are customized by the retailer, where they specify the ingredients, formulation, and branding to suit their market needs. This allows for greater control over quality and marketing strategies.

In contrast, white label products are generic formulations produced by a manufacturer that can be sold under different brand names. Retailers simply attach their brand and sell the products as their own. While both options can provide retailers with quick inventory, private labeling offers more unique branding opportunities, which is particularly valuable in a crowded marketplace.

Components of Private Label Liquid B Complex

Essential B Vitamins and Their Functions

Private label liquid B complex products typically contain a combination of essential B vitamins, each serving critical roles in maintaining good health:

  • Vitamin B1 (Thiamine): Vital for converting carbohydrates into energy and supports proper cardiovascular function.
  • Vitamin B2 (Riboflavin): Plays a key role in energy production and cellular function, and helps maintain healthy skin and eyes.
  • Vitamin B3 (Niacin): Crucial for converting food into energy and maintaining healthy cholesterol levels.
  • Vitamin B5 (Pantothenic Acid): Important for synthesizing coenzyme A, necessary for fatty acid metabolism.
  • Vitamin B6 (Pyridoxine): Supports neurotransmitter synthesis, immune function, and the production of hemoglobin.
  • Vitamin B7 (Biotin): Essential for carbohydrate and fat metabolism and contributes to healthy hair, skin, and nails.
  • Vitamin B9 (Folate): Critical for DNA synthesis and repair, and is especially important for fetal development during pregnancy.
  • Vitamin B12 (Cobalamin): Essential for red blood cell formation and neurological function.

Formulations: Custom vs. Standard Options

When selecting a private label liquid B complex, businesses typically have two formulation choices: custom or standard. Custom formulations allow companies to create unique blends tailored to specific health benefits or target markets. This might include adjusting the ratio of vitamins based on particular consumer needs, such as athletic performance enhancement, stress reduction, or prenatal support.

Standard formulations, on the other hand, provide a ready-to-market option that meets general consumer demands. These formulations are often more cost-effective and quicker to launch, making them attractive for businesses looking to test the market without high initial investments. Both options have their merits, and the choice largely depends on brand goals, target demographics, and budget considerations.

Certifications and Quality Assurance

Quality assurance is paramount in the supplement industry. Make sure your chosen manufacturer has relevant certifications, including:

  • GMP Certification: Good Manufacturing Practices certification indicates compliance with industry regulations concerning safety and quality.
  • NSF Certification: Ensures that the product meets stringent safety and quality standards.
  • Non-GMO and Organic Certifications: Especially important if your target audience is health-conscious, these certifications can enhance marketability.

Regular third-party testing is also an important aspect of quality assurance that validates the product’s claims and ensures consistency across batches.
